Artificial intelligence is like having a super-smart robot friend who helps people do their jobs faster and better.
Imagine you have a big puzzle with hundreds of pieces, it takes a long time to solve by yourself. Now imagine your robot friend can look at the whole picture, figure out where each piece goes in seconds, and put them all together while you take a nap. That’s what artificial intelligence does for people every day.
How It Helps People Work
At school or work, AI is like that smart robot friend who helps you finish your homework or your tasks quicker. For example, when you use a phone to ask for directions, the phone uses AI to find the best way to get where you need to go, just like how your friend might help you choose the fastest route to the park.
How It Changes Everyday Life
AI can also change how people live. Think about a smart toy that learns what games you like and plays with you in new ways each day. That’s AI learning from you, just like a friend who gets better at playing games as they spend more time with you.
In the future, AI might even help doctors find sicknesses faster or let your fridge tell you when you need to buy more milk, it's like having a helpful robot in every place you go!
